About the Role

The Company is seeking an Executive Director to lead its well-established, highly credible organization into a new phase of development. The successful candidate will be responsible for sustaining and growing the institution, with a focus on modernizing operations, centering inclusion, and elevating visibility. This role involves strategic leadership, community partnerships, and a commitment to the company's mission of celebrating and preserving the diverse heritage of the region. The Executive Director will be tasked with leveraging successful programming, exploring innovative ways to engage the community, and ensuring the organization's physical spaces meet the needs of patrons. Additionally, the role includes assessing, leading, and growing a team of professionals, as well as securing and growing philanthropic funding. The ideal candidate for the Executive Director position at the company will be a seasoned nonprofit organizational leader with a passion for history. Key skills and qualities include being a strategic thinker, a collaborative team builder, an innovative fundraiser, and a natural relationship builder. The candidate should be a compelling public speaker, capable of weaving stories and bringing history to life, and should have a deep understanding of the challenges and opportunities within the region. Experience in utilizing history to engage communities and a commitment to inclusion and belonging are essential. The role requires a leader who can think strategically about the company's role in bringing diverse communities together and who is dedicated to the mission of the organization.
